Obtaining Repair Service (Worldwide)
To obtain service for your instrument (in-warranty, under service contract, or
post-warranty), contact your nearest Agilent Technologies Service Center. They will
arrange to have your unit repaired or replaced, and can provide warranty or repair-cost
information where applicable.

Before shipping your instrument, ask the Agilent Technologies Service Center to provide
shipping instructions, including what components to ship. Agilent recommends that you
retain the original shipping carton for use in such shipments.

Cleaning

Clean the outside of the instrument with a soft, lint–free, slightly dampened cloth. Do
not use detergent. Disassembly is not required or recommended for cleaning.
